Yorktown, TX Facts, Population, Income, Demographics, Economy

Population (total): Population in 2017: 2,080 (0% urban, 100% rural). >Population change since 2000: -8.4%

Population (male): 983

Population (female): 1,097

Median Age: 50.4 years

Median Rent: Median gross rent in 2017: $660.

Cost of Living: March 2019 cost of living index in Yorktown: 79.0 (low, U.S. average is 100)

Poverty (breakdown): (10.7% for White Non-Hispanic residents, 23.1% for Black residents, 32.9% for Hispanic or Latino residents, 31.7% for other race residents, 83.6% for two or more races residents)

Sex Offenders: According to our research of Texas and other state lists, there were 13 registered sex offenders living in Yorktown, Texas as of January 16, 2021. The ratio of all residents to sex offenders in Yorktown is 133 to 1.>

Elevation: 273 feet

Land Area: 1.72 square miles.

Drug, Alcohol, DNA Testing Methods And Services

Drug and Alcohol Testing

Testing purposes can include pre-employment, random, post-accident, court ordered probation, school programs and personal reasons. DOT and non-DOT drug and alcohol testing is available. Testing centers offer 5, 7, 9, 12 and 14 panel drug screenings and all drug tests are analyzed by a SAMHSA Certified laboratory and all test results are verified by a licensed Medical Review Officer. Instant result testing is also available at most testing centers. Drug and Alcohol testing methods can include urine, hair, ETG, breath alcohol (BAC), blood and oral saliva. The detection period for drug and alcohol use is determined by the testing methods and the laboratory analysis utilized. DNA Testing

DNA testing is provided for various purposes including paternity, child custody, immigration and other legal proceedings. The DNA test is 99.9% accurate and is a simple swabbing of the mouth process. All DNA tests are analyzed by certified AABB laboratories and can be utilized in any legal proceeding.

Local Area Info: Yorktown, Texas

Yorktown is located in southwestern DeWitt County at 28°59?00?N 97°30?09?W? / ?28.983196°N 97.502415°W? / 28.983196; -97.502415Coordinates: 28°59?00?N 97°30?09?W? / ?28.983196°N 97.502415°W? / 28.983196; -97.502415 (28.983196, -97.502415). State Highways 72 and 119 intersect on the western side of town. Highway 72 leads northeast 16 miles (26 km) to Cuero and southwest 25 miles (40 km) to Kenedy, while Highway 119 leads northwest 35 miles (56 km) to Stockdale and south 24 miles (39 km) to Goliad.

The climate in this area is characterized by hot, humid summers and generally mild to cool winters. According to the Köppen Climate Classification system, Yorktown has a humid subtropical climate, abbreviated "Cfa" on climate maps.

As of the census of 2000, there were 2,271 people, 864 households, and 584 families residing in the city. The population density was 1,318.1 people per square mile (509.8/km²). There were 1,048 housing units at an average density of 608.3 per square mile (235.3/km²). The racial makeup of the city was 79.83% White, 2.99% African American, 0.40% Native American, 15.32% from other races, and 1.45%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 37.60% of the population.
